2019 House Bill 4675

Require “strict discipline academies” admit certain problem children

Introduced in the House

May 24, 2019

Introduced by Rep. Lynn Afendoulis (R-73)

To require “strict discipline academy” charter schools to enroll a minor who requires “tier 3 supports,” meaning “intense individual intervention for a pupil with highly accelerated or severe and persistently challenging academic or nonacademic needs.” This refers to schools authorized by the state school code for students whose conduct threatens the safety of staff and other students in regular schools.
